{screwcap, 13.5%} Glowing bright garnet. Intense colour. Bright, almost hard nose of cherry pip and cranberry. Light, ripe, not quite as hard as say, Otago often is, but still pretty superficial. Slightly spritzy acid initially, low gritty tannins, lightly chewy texture, but not oaky. Sits on the front of the tongue and fades fairly quickly on the finish, but is dry and refreshing. Not for cellaring however.
